Dispatching
The process of sending off goods or a workforce to their destination or for a specific task.
Production Steps
The series of phases or actions taken to manufacture a product, from raw materials to the final goods.
Forward Scheduling
A planning method that starts from a particular date and moves forward in time to determine the timeline for project or production activities.
Backward Scheduling
A method of scheduling tasks starting with the end goal and working backward to determine the necessary steps and timing.
